Verda selects Supermicro liquid-cooled Blackwell for European AI cloud
AFBytes Brief
Verda chose Supermicro liquid-cooled NVIDIA Blackwell servers to build an AI cloud aimed at regulated European customers. The project emphasizes sustainable cooling methods for large-scale inference workloads.
